The Mobile Wallet now has a number of exciting new features thanks to the latest update. Mobile Wallet V 0.3.13 now includes the SelfKey ID which allows you to register for and access service providers listed in the Marketplace or integrated with Login with SelfKey.
Another exciting new feature is that you can now unlock the Mobile Wallet with your biometrics! Once your account is set up on the Mobile Wallet, you now have the option to login with your fingerprint if you use an Android device. For iOS devices, you can now login with FaceID and TouchID. This is a feature that the community has shown great interest in, and we are delighted to be able to bring it to you now.
Lastly, you can now import your wallet using your seed phrase. This is particularly convenient when you want to have access to your tokens and identity documents from a new device.
Additionally, we launched V 1.6.3 of the Desktop Wallet! This new update fixes bugs in send transaction screens and most importantly, auto update. We’ve continued to update our comprehensive list of data breaches. As of June 2020, AT LEAST 16 billion records, including credit card numbers, home addresses, phone numbers and other highly sensitive information, have been exposed through data breaches since 2019. The first quarter of 2020 has been one of the worst in data breach history, with over 8 billion records exposed.
